So now that you've made up your mind to start investing, where do you place all that hard-earned income? There are a multitude of investments that you can get into, but you have to be able to choose carefully. Here are some of the more popular options:

*Starting your own business. This is one of the best options if you feel that you have an interest or hobby that you can capitalize on. But to be able to run a business adequately, you must have the ability to dedicate a lot of time to it. This is not the preferred option if you are currently employed.

*Invest in stocks. When many people think of investing, they immediately think of stocks. Essentially having a share in the ownership of a company, stocks have one of the best opportunities for high yield. Do not be disillusioned by that possibility, though, as stocks are also the investment with one of the highest risks. If you do decide to invest in stocks, make sure that you have thoroughly studied about it.

*Bond investing. A bond is a debt security, where an authorized issuer borrows money from you. They will pay you back in parts semiannually. When compared to stocks, bonds are seen as the safer ways to invest, but it also gives out one of the lowest amounts of yield. You can, of course, make it more exciting by buying or selling bonds before it matures. Doing so may increase the profits, but doing so will also increase the risk factor.

*Get a mutual fund. These mutual funds are federal approved; the increased security is important because the managers of a mutual fund company will be the ones making the investment decisions for you. At the end of each year, an investor will get a report of where his or her money is, and how much it has grown. This is a very attractive choice for those that want to invest in something, but feel like they can't afford to do it by themselves.

So those are some of the most popular investments for people who like to think forward. So long as you know what you're doing, investing in any of these will help your money grow.
